I didn't read through all of your code but here is the method I have
been using with success.
var op:Operation = service.getOperation("GetDataByGrouping") as Operation;
op.resultFormat = "e4x";
// temp object to store arguments
var args:Object = new Object();
args.groupingRequests = new Object();
args.groupingRequests.GroupName = "RPRToolStaticData";
op.arguments = args;
service.GetDataByGrouping();

> Hello,
>
> I'm trying to send some arguments to a webservice, but every
> variation I have tried other than generating the XML from scratch
> keeps failing (eg. sends an empty message body). Relevant parts of
> the WSDL are as follows:
>
> <message name="sendStrings">
> <part element="tns:sendStrings" name="parameters"></part>
> </message>
> <message name="sendStringsResponse">
> <part element="tns:sendStringsResponse"
> name="parameters"></part>
> </message>
> ...
> <operation name="sendStrings">
> <input message="tns:sendStrings"></input>
> <output message="tns:sendStringsResponse"></output>
> </operation>
>
> And from the XSD:
>
> <xs:element
> xmlns:ns3="http://server.webservices.tutorials.wakaleo.com/"
> type="ns3:sendStrings" name="sendStrings"></xs:element>
>
> <xs:complexType name="sendStrings">
> <xs:sequence>
> <xs:element type="xs:string" minOccurs="0" name="arg0"
> maxOccurs="unbounded"></xs:element>
> </xs:sequence>
> </xs:complexType>
>
> <xs:element
> xmlns:ns4="http://server.webservices.tutorials.wakaleo.com/"
> type="ns4:sendStringsResponse"
> name="sendStringsResponse"></xs:element>
>
> <xs:complexType name="sendStringsResponse">
> <xs:sequence>
> <xs:element type="xs:string" minOccurs="0" name="return"
> maxOccurs="unbounded"></xs:element>
> </xs:sequence>
> </xs:complexType>
>
> Based on everything that I have been able to find in the
> documentation and on flexcoders, there are a number of different
> ways to send requests to the web service, so I tried each of the
> ones that I could find.
>
> However, only one of them succeeds -- specifically, the case where I
> build an XMLDocument from scratch and send it. All the other cases
> fail -- that is, they do not pass *any* arguments to the web
> service.
